excel根据数据自动画cad
作者:excel百科网
|
380人看过
发布时间:2026-01-20 00:13:55
标签:
excel根据数据自动画cad在现代数据处理与可视化领域,Excel作为一种广泛使用的工具,凭借其强大的数据处理能力,已经成为企业、科研和日常办公中不可或缺的辅助工具。然而,Excel本身并不具备图形绘制功能,因此,许多用户希望能够在
excel根据数据自动画cad
在现代数据处理与可视化领域,Excel作为一种广泛使用的工具,凭借其强大的数据处理能力,已经成为企业、科研和日常办公中不可或缺的辅助工具。然而,Excel本身并不具备图形绘制功能,因此,许多用户希望能够在Excel中实现数据可视化,甚至自动绘制CAD图纸。本文将详细介绍如何利用Excel的公式与功能,实现数据自动画CAD的全过程,从数据准备到图表生成,再到图层管理与自动化操作,全面解析这一技术实现的逻辑与方法。
一、数据准备与数据清洗
在进行数据自动画CAD之前,首先需要确保数据的完整性与准确性。CAD图纸通常由多个数据元素组成,包括点、线、面、多边形、文本、图层等。因此,在Excel中,数据的结构需要清晰,以便后续处理。
1.1 数据结构的设计
数据应以表格形式呈现,列包括:X坐标、Y坐标、图形类型(如点、线、多边形)、颜色、线宽、图层等。例如:
| 图形类型 | X坐标 | Y坐标 | 颜色 | 线宽 | 图层 |
|-|--|--||||
| 点 | 10 | 20 | 红色 | 1 | 0 |
| 线 | 10 | 20 | 蓝色 | 2 | 1 |
| 多边形 | 10 | 20 | 绿色 | 3 | 2 |
1.2 数据清洗与标准化
数据清洗是数据自动画CAD的前提条件。需要检查数据是否完整,是否有重复或缺失值。例如,如果某张图层中存在空值,需要进行填充或删除。此外,数据应统一单位,如所有坐标单位统一为毫米,确保数据的一致性。
二、使用Excel公式生成基本图形
Excel具备强大的公式功能,可以实现数据自动画CAD的基础图形,如点、线、多边形等。
2.1 生成点
点的绘制通常使用`POINT`函数,语法如下:
excel
=POINT(X, Y)
将公式输入到A1单元格,然后复制到其他单元格,即可生成多个点。
2.2 生成线
线的绘制可以使用`LINE`函数,语法如下:
excel
=LINE(X1, Y1, X2, Y2)
将公式输入到A2单元格,然后复制到其他单元格,即可生成连接两个点的线。
2.3 生成多边形
多边形的绘制可以使用`POLY`函数,语法如下:
excel
=POLY(X1, Y1, X2, Y2, X3, Y3, ..., Xn, Yn)
将公式输入到A3单元格,然后复制到其他单元格,即可生成多边形。
三、使用图表功能实现图形绘制
Excel的图表功能可以实现数据自动画CAD的高级图形,如折线图、柱状图、饼图等,这些图表可以作为CAD图纸的基础元素。
3.1 折线图
折线图可以表示数据之间的关系,适用于绘制趋势线。在Excel中,可以通过“插入折线图”功能生成折线图,然后将图层设置为“图层1”。
3.2 柱状图
柱状图适用于表示数据的分布情况,可以将数据作为柱状图的条形,形成CAD图纸的结构。
3.3 饼图
饼图适用于表示数据的占比情况,可以将数据作为饼图的扇形,形成CAD图纸的结构。
四、图层管理与图形分类
在CAD图纸中,图层管理是关键。Excel中的图层可以通过“设置图层”功能进行管理,确保不同类型的图形在同一图层上,便于后续编辑和调整。
4.1 图层设置
在Excel中,可以通过“设置图层”功能,为不同类型的图形设置不同的图层,如“点图层”、“线图层”、“多边形图层”等。
4.2 图层切换
在生成图形后,可以通过切换图层来调整图形的显示状态,例如显示点、隐藏线,或者反之。
五、自动化绘图与数据驱动
Excel的自动化功能可以实现数据驱动的图形生成,例如使用VBA宏或Power Query实现数据自动画CAD的流程。
5.1 VBA宏实现
VBA宏可以实现数据自动画CAD的自动化流程,包括数据导入、图形生成、图层管理、输出图纸等。例如,使用VBA宏可以将Excel中的数据自动绘制为CAD图纸。
5.2 Power Query实现
Power Query可以实现数据的自动化处理,包括数据清洗、转换和加载,然后通过图表功能生成图形。
六、CAD图纸的输出与导出
在完成数据自动画CAD后,需要将图形导出为CAD格式,如DXF、DWG等,以便在CAD软件中进行进一步编辑。
6.1 导出为DXF格式
在Excel中,可以使用“另存为”功能,将图形保存为DXF格式,这是CAD图纸的常用格式。
6.2 导出为DWG格式
对于更专业的CAD图纸,可以使用CAD软件直接导入Excel数据,生成DWG格式的图纸。
七、数据自动画CAD的注意事项
在进行数据自动画CAD时,需要注意以下几个方面:
7.1 数据准确性
数据的准确性直接影响到CAD图纸的质量,因此在数据准备阶段需要仔细检查。
7.2 图形格式统一
所有图形应统一格式,包括颜色、线宽、图层等,确保图形在CAD中显示一致。
7.3 图形编辑的灵活性
在CAD中,图形可以进行编辑和调整,因此在Excel中生成的图形应具备一定的灵活性,便于后续修改。
八、实际应用案例
在实际应用中,数据自动画CAD可以用于工程设计、建筑规划、市场分析等多个领域。例如,在建筑规划中,可以使用Excel生成建筑平面图,将数据自动绘制为CAD图纸,提高设计效率。
8.1 建筑规划案例
在建筑规划中,可以将建筑平面图的数据导入Excel,生成点、线、多边形等图形,然后导出为CAD图纸,用于实际施工。
8.2 市场分析案例
在市场分析中,可以将销售数据导入Excel,生成折线图和柱状图,形成市场趋势图,作为CAD图纸的结构。
九、总结
在Excel中实现数据自动画CAD,需要从数据准备、图形生成、图层管理、自动化操作等多个方面进行考虑。通过Excel的公式、图表功能、VBA宏和Power Query等工具,可以实现数据驱动的图形绘制,提高工作效率,减少人工操作。同时,注意事项的掌握,如数据准确性、图形格式统一、图形编辑灵活性等,也是实现高质量CAD图纸的关键。
通过以上方法,可以实现Excel数据自动画CAD的完整流程,为各类数据处理和可视化需求提供有力支持。
在现代数据处理与可视化领域,Excel作为一种广泛使用的工具,凭借其强大的数据处理能力,已经成为企业、科研和日常办公中不可或缺的辅助工具。然而,Excel本身并不具备图形绘制功能,因此,许多用户希望能够在Excel中实现数据可视化,甚至自动绘制CAD图纸。本文将详细介绍如何利用Excel的公式与功能,实现数据自动画CAD的全过程,从数据准备到图表生成,再到图层管理与自动化操作,全面解析这一技术实现的逻辑与方法。
一、数据准备与数据清洗
在进行数据自动画CAD之前,首先需要确保数据的完整性与准确性。CAD图纸通常由多个数据元素组成,包括点、线、面、多边形、文本、图层等。因此,在Excel中,数据的结构需要清晰,以便后续处理。
1.1 数据结构的设计
数据应以表格形式呈现,列包括:X坐标、Y坐标、图形类型(如点、线、多边形)、颜色、线宽、图层等。例如:
| 图形类型 | X坐标 | Y坐标 | 颜色 | 线宽 | 图层 |
|-|--|--||||
| 点 | 10 | 20 | 红色 | 1 | 0 |
| 线 | 10 | 20 | 蓝色 | 2 | 1 |
| 多边形 | 10 | 20 | 绿色 | 3 | 2 |
1.2 数据清洗与标准化
数据清洗是数据自动画CAD的前提条件。需要检查数据是否完整,是否有重复或缺失值。例如,如果某张图层中存在空值,需要进行填充或删除。此外,数据应统一单位,如所有坐标单位统一为毫米,确保数据的一致性。
二、使用Excel公式生成基本图形
Excel具备强大的公式功能,可以实现数据自动画CAD的基础图形,如点、线、多边形等。
2.1 生成点
点的绘制通常使用`POINT`函数,语法如下:
excel
=POINT(X, Y)
将公式输入到A1单元格,然后复制到其他单元格,即可生成多个点。
2.2 生成线
线的绘制可以使用`LINE`函数,语法如下:
excel
=LINE(X1, Y1, X2, Y2)
将公式输入到A2单元格,然后复制到其他单元格,即可生成连接两个点的线。
2.3 生成多边形
多边形的绘制可以使用`POLY`函数,语法如下:
excel
=POLY(X1, Y1, X2, Y2, X3, Y3, ..., Xn, Yn)
将公式输入到A3单元格,然后复制到其他单元格,即可生成多边形。
三、使用图表功能实现图形绘制
Excel的图表功能可以实现数据自动画CAD的高级图形,如折线图、柱状图、饼图等,这些图表可以作为CAD图纸的基础元素。
3.1 折线图
折线图可以表示数据之间的关系,适用于绘制趋势线。在Excel中,可以通过“插入折线图”功能生成折线图,然后将图层设置为“图层1”。
3.2 柱状图
柱状图适用于表示数据的分布情况,可以将数据作为柱状图的条形,形成CAD图纸的结构。
3.3 饼图
饼图适用于表示数据的占比情况,可以将数据作为饼图的扇形,形成CAD图纸的结构。
四、图层管理与图形分类
在CAD图纸中,图层管理是关键。Excel中的图层可以通过“设置图层”功能进行管理,确保不同类型的图形在同一图层上,便于后续编辑和调整。
4.1 图层设置
在Excel中,可以通过“设置图层”功能,为不同类型的图形设置不同的图层,如“点图层”、“线图层”、“多边形图层”等。
4.2 图层切换
在生成图形后,可以通过切换图层来调整图形的显示状态,例如显示点、隐藏线,或者反之。
五、自动化绘图与数据驱动
Excel的自动化功能可以实现数据驱动的图形生成,例如使用VBA宏或Power Query实现数据自动画CAD的流程。
5.1 VBA宏实现
VBA宏可以实现数据自动画CAD的自动化流程,包括数据导入、图形生成、图层管理、输出图纸等。例如,使用VBA宏可以将Excel中的数据自动绘制为CAD图纸。
5.2 Power Query实现
Power Query可以实现数据的自动化处理,包括数据清洗、转换和加载,然后通过图表功能生成图形。
六、CAD图纸的输出与导出
在完成数据自动画CAD后,需要将图形导出为CAD格式,如DXF、DWG等,以便在CAD软件中进行进一步编辑。
6.1 导出为DXF格式
在Excel中,可以使用“另存为”功能,将图形保存为DXF格式,这是CAD图纸的常用格式。
6.2 导出为DWG格式
对于更专业的CAD图纸,可以使用CAD软件直接导入Excel数据,生成DWG格式的图纸。
七、数据自动画CAD的注意事项
在进行数据自动画CAD时,需要注意以下几个方面:
7.1 数据准确性
数据的准确性直接影响到CAD图纸的质量,因此在数据准备阶段需要仔细检查。
7.2 图形格式统一
所有图形应统一格式,包括颜色、线宽、图层等,确保图形在CAD中显示一致。
7.3 图形编辑的灵活性
在CAD中,图形可以进行编辑和调整,因此在Excel中生成的图形应具备一定的灵活性,便于后续修改。
八、实际应用案例
在实际应用中,数据自动画CAD可以用于工程设计、建筑规划、市场分析等多个领域。例如,在建筑规划中,可以使用Excel生成建筑平面图,将数据自动绘制为CAD图纸,提高设计效率。
8.1 建筑规划案例
在建筑规划中,可以将建筑平面图的数据导入Excel,生成点、线、多边形等图形,然后导出为CAD图纸,用于实际施工。
8.2 市场分析案例
在市场分析中,可以将销售数据导入Excel,生成折线图和柱状图,形成市场趋势图,作为CAD图纸的结构。
九、总结
在Excel中实现数据自动画CAD,需要从数据准备、图形生成、图层管理、自动化操作等多个方面进行考虑。通过Excel的公式、图表功能、VBA宏和Power Query等工具,可以实现数据驱动的图形绘制,提高工作效率,减少人工操作。同时,注意事项的掌握,如数据准确性、图形格式统一、图形编辑灵活性等,也是实现高质量CAD图纸的关键。
通过以上方法,可以实现Excel数据自动画CAD的完整流程,为各类数据处理和可视化需求提供有力支持。
推荐文章
如何删除Excel整列数据:全面指南与实用技巧在Excel中,数据的整理与清理是数据分析和报表制作中不可或缺的一环。当数据量较大时,删除整列数据往往成为一项常见任务。然而,对于初学者来说,这一操作可能显得有些复杂,甚至让人产生困惑。本
2026-01-20 00:13:39
355人看过
Excel表格数据转树状图:从基础到高级的实践指南Excel 是企业级数据处理的常用工具,而在实际操作中,数据往往不是孤立存在的。当数据呈现出层次结构时,比如“部门-员工-项目”这样的关系,如何将这些数据以树状图的形式直观展示,是提升
2026-01-20 00:13:36
243人看过
Excel显示数据超出范围的常见问题与解决方法在使用Excel处理数据时,经常会遇到“数据超出范围”这一提示。这一问题通常出现在数据输入或公式计算过程中,可能是由于数据格式不一致、数据超出列宽、公式引用错误或数据类型不匹配等原因引起。
2026-01-20 00:13:32
358人看过
Excel数据批量删除查重:实用技巧与深度解析在数据处理中,Excel 是一个不可或缺的工具,尤其在处理大量数据时,其功能和效率显得尤为重要。Excel 提供了多种数据操作功能,其中包括批量删除和查重操作。这些功能在数据清洗、数据整理
2026-01-20 00:12:55
233人看过
.webp)


